Understanding the global compliance landscape
Why certification matters for an amusement park manufacturer
Rides are high-consequence products: a failure can cause severe injury, reputational damage and legal exposure. Buyers—theme parks, city councils, leisure operators—require proof that equipment meets local safety and quality standards. Certifications such as CE in the European Union, UKCA in the United Kingdom, SABER for Saudi imports, TÜV-related approvals in parts of Europe, and ASTM-based compliance expectations in the United States are gatekeepers for market entry. Official sources like the European Commission's CE guidance and the UK government’s UKCA documentation provide the legal framing for these marks (EC: CE marking, UK: UKCA guidance).
Key international standards and where to start
As an engineer and consultant, I advise starting with the core standards that define ride safety. For example, ASTM has standards specific to amusement devices and F2291 (design of amusement rides) is widely referenced in North America (ASTM International). The EU Machinery Directive and harmonized standards drive CE conformity in Europe (see the Machinery Directive text at eur-lex). ISO also provides machine safety guidance (see ISO). Mapping which standard applies to each target market is the first practical step.
Common regulatory pitfalls and how to avoid them
Manufacturers often underestimate differences in documentation expectations, testing protocols and on-site verification. To avoid delays I recommend: (1) early dialogue with notified bodies or accredited testing labs, (2) design-for-certification—embedding standards requirements into drawings and FMEA documents, and (3) preparing a certification dossier (technical file) that includes risk assessments, material certificates, welding procedures, control system logic, and maintenance manuals. These items speed reviews and reduce rework.
Practical steps to cross regulatory boundaries
Step 1 — Regulatory mapping and market prioritization
I begin projects by mapping the regulatory requirements of each target market, ranking markets by revenue potential versus certification complexity. For example, entry to the EU requires CE and conformity to harmonized standards; entry to Saudi Arabia may require SABER clearance; the US market expects ASTM-based documentation plus local jurisdiction acceptance. The mapping outcome drives investment: which test reports to obtain, where to seek notified body support, and which design changes are needed.
Step 2 — Design adaptation and engineering controls
Design adaptation means more than swapping bolts. It can require: different structural factor-of-safety assumptions, alternate electrical protection for 60Hz vs 50Hz systems, climate-adapted coatings for coastal installations, and localization of control logic and signage languages. I insist on modular design where the core mechanical module is universal and region-specific modules (electrical, control, interfaces) are swapped per market. This reduces re-certification cost and lead time.
Step 3 — Testing, documentation and notified body engagement
Testing must be planned: static and dynamic load tests, non-destructive testing (NDT) of welds, electromagnetic compatibility (EMC) and electrical safety checks, and control-system validation. Engaging a notified body or accredited lab early avoids surprises. For reference, many jurisdictions accept TÜV reports or lab accreditation from bodies listed by national accreditation entities (TÜV Rheinland).
Supply chain, manufacturing controls and logistics
Quality systems and factory audit readiness
Export success requires robust quality management on the factory floor. I recommend ISO 9001-compliant processes, a documented Inspection Test Plan (ITP) for each product, and pre-shipment checks that include packaging verification for long-sea transit. Factory acceptance tests (FATs) emulate site commissioning and are often a contractual milestone.
Choosing logistics and managing customs (including SABER)
Logistics choices must reflect the product’s value density and project timelines. For large rides, sea freight with RORO or containerization is common; for urgent spares, air freight is necessary. For Saudi Arabia, SABER clearance is commonly required—exporters should register and prepare product technical documents as SABER requires (SABER).
Insurance, incoterms and installation coordination
Use appropriate Incoterms (e.g., DAP or CIF) that match the client's risk expectations and ensure transit insurance covers the full transport route. Pre-define responsibilities for site foundations, anchorage grouting, and local labor. Because installations often fail due to poor site preps, I supply checklists and remote site review services prior to shipment.
Commercial strategy, after-sales and local partnerships
Local representation, spare parts strategy and training
Local partners reduce friction: they handle import clearance, provide on-the-ground maintenance and deliver spare parts faster. I typically recommend a two-tier spare parts plan: a short-term kit for first-year operation and a stocked spares list for long-term support. Comprehensive operator and maintenance training—delivered on-site and in local language—mitigates misuse and speeds commissioning.
Warranty, liability and contractual safeguards
Align warranty periods with local expectations and define exclusions clearly (e.g., misuse, natural disasters). Include acceptance criteria for performance tests at commissioning, and define dispute resolution mechanisms and applicable law. These contractual details can make or break an export sale.

Comparative table: common certifications and what they mean
| Certification | Region | Primary scope | Typical lead time | Reference |
|---|---|---|---|---|
| CE (Conformité Européenne) | European Union | Machinery safety, EMC, materials—declared conformity for market access | 2–6 months (depending on harmonized standards) | EC: CE marking |
| UKCA | United Kingdom | UK-specific conformity marking replacing CE for GB | 1–4 months | UK: UKCA guidance |
| SABER | Saudi Arabia | Import clearance system requiring technical documentation and conformity | Varies; registration time may add weeks | SABER |
| TÜV / Notified bodies | Europe & global (recognized reports) | Third-party testing and inspection; widely recognized for quality | 2–8 weeks for testing; longer if corrective work needed | TÜV Rheinland |
| ASTM standards | United States (widely accepted globally) | Detailed design and testing standards for amusement rides | Ongoing—standards guide design; testing schedule as per project | ASTM |
Sources listed above (EC, UK Gov, SABER, TÜV, ASTM) are authoritative starting points for compliance planning.

Common questions (FAQ)
1. What certifications do I need to export amusement rides?
It depends on the destination. For Europe, CE and conformity to harmonized standards (e.g., Machinery Directive) are usually required; in the UK, UKCA applies; Saudi Arabia often requires SABER clearance; in the US buyers expect ASTM compliance and local authority acceptance. Start by mapping target markets to specific standards and local authorities.
2. How long does certification typically take?
Lead time varies: simple documentation-based CE conformity can take a few weeks to a few months; third-party testing and corrective design work extend timelines. Plan at least 2–6 months for secure, well-documented certification streams when entering major markets.
3. How should I manage spare parts and service across multiple countries?
Define a tiered spare parts strategy: essential wear-and-tear parts stocked regionally, critical long-lead items shipped from the manufacturer. Also set up local service agreements or authorized service partners to reduce response time and ensure trained technicians are available.
4. Can I design a single ride platform for multiple markets?
Yes—by using a modular approach. Keep a universal mechanical core and swap region-specific modules (electrical, control software, signage). This minimizes re-testing and accelerates approval in additional markets.
5. What are the most common causes of installation delays?
Installation delays often stem from inadequate site preparation (foundations, access, power), customs clearance hold-ups, missing documentation for local authorities, or late delivery of critical spares. A coordinated pre-shipment checklist and early site surveys mitigate these risks.
6. How do I verify that a supplier’s certification is legitimate?
Ask for raw test reports, the notified body identification, and the technical file. Confirm the notified body’s accreditation on national accreditation authority websites and request contact details for previous clients or installed references.
